Hawaii's tropical climate, characterized by high humidity, frequent rain showers, and strong coastal winds, demands roofing materials that can withstand constant exposure. Corrugated metal roofing is an excellent choice for its durability, resistance to corrosion (with proper coatings), and ability to handle wind uplift. Our installation focuses on ensuring all seams are meticulously sealed to prevent water intrusion during heavy downpours and that panels are securely fastened to withstand the persistent trade winds common across the islands.

How does Hawaii's weather affect corrugated metal roofs?

Hawaii's high humidity and salt air necessitate corrugated metal roofs with robust, corrosion-resistant coatings. Frequent rain requires meticulous sealing of seams to prevent leaks. Strong trade winds demand secure fastening systems designed to withstand constant uplift pressure, making proper installation crucial for longevity in this environment.
